I host a couple of client sites with this plugin. I use wp-cli for a lot of site management tasks. When I run a wp-cli command on those sites, e.g. wp plugin list, I get this, and the wp-cli command fails to run:
PHP Warning: Undefined array key "SERVER_NAME" in /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php on line 85
Warning: Undefined array key "SERVER_NAME" in /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php on line 85
PHP Fatal error: Uncaught ValueError: setcookie(): Argument #1 ($name) cannot be empty in /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php:99
Stack trace:
#0 /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php(99): setcookie()
#1 /var/www/mysite.com/htdocs/wp-includes/class-wp-hook.php(308): CTCF7_SetLandingInfo()
#2 /var/www/mysite.com/htdocs/wp-includes/class-wp-hook.php(332): WP_Hook->apply_filters()
#3 /var/www/mysite.com/htdocs/wp-includes/plugin.php(517): WP_Hook->do_action()
#4 /var/www/mysite.com/htdocs/wp-settings.php(617): do_action()
#5 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/WP_CLI/Runner.php(1336): require('...')
#6 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/WP_CLI/Runner.php(1254): WP_CLI\Runner->load_wordpress()
#7 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/WP_CLI/Bootstrap/LaunchRunner.php(28): WP_CLI\Runner->start()
#8 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/bootstrap.php(78): WP_CLI\Bootstrap\LaunchRunner->process()
#9 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/wp-cli.php(32): WP_CLI\bootstrap()
#10 phar:///usr/local/bin/wp/php/boot-phar.php(11): include('...')
#11 /usr/local/bin/wp(4): include('...')
#12 {main}
thrown in /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php on line 99
Fatal error: Uncaught ValueError: setcookie(): Argument #1 ($name) cannot be empty in /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php:99
Stack trace:
#0 /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php(99): setcookie()
#1 /var/www/mysite.com/htdocs/wp-includes/class-wp-hook.php(308): CTCF7_SetLandingInfo()
#2 /var/www/mysite.com/htdocs/wp-includes/class-wp-hook.php(332): WP_Hook->apply_filters()
#3 /var/www/mysite.com/htdocs/wp-includes/plugin.php(517): WP_Hook->do_action()
#4 /var/www/mysite.com/htdocs/wp-settings.php(617): do_action()
#5 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/WP_CLI/Runner.php(1336): require('...')
#6 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/WP_CLI/Runner.php(1254): WP_CLI\Runner->load_wordpress()
#7 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/WP_CLI/Bootstrap/LaunchRunner.php(28): WP_CLI\Runner->start()
#8 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/bootstrap.php(78): WP_CLI\Bootstrap\LaunchRunner->process()
#9 phar:///usr/local/bin/wp/vendor/wp-cli/wp-cli/php/wp-cli.php(32): WP_CLI\bootstrap()
#10 phar:///usr/local/bin/wp/php/boot-phar.php(11): include('...')
#11 /usr/local/bin/wp(4): include('...')
#12 {main}
thrown in /var/www/mysite.com/htdocs/wp-content/plugins/conversion-tracking-for-contact-form-7/conversion-tracking-for-cf7.php on line 99
Error: There has been a critical error on this website.Learn more about troubleshooting WordPress. There has been a critical error on this website.
Can you release a fix for this? Both sites are running PHP7.4 but I want to update them to PHP8.1 once this is resolved.
Thanks in advance.
]]>Hello,
The filled on from and from page urls are not showing properly.
-- Tracking Info --
The user filled the form on: https://u18544399.ct.sendgrid.net/ls/click?upn=5LVMxQd3-2FHvWwxp6S7rln-2BXghgvlzP7szWMqCDX-2BBzuF5GQTyH-2FMy89c41rU8YoFJPrfzwbFEj725-2FWIC7mXjA-3D-3DeIBP_EYd3yy3irBU3zwlsicGM1Hzrm5Je3eXAF7oRZNqeNtcWGBmfX9iEICOO1xxhIt-2FIOpZMOlPDmBkViDGt3lijayNr1FAGVH8Vvro59tE7LznXPCdTGW1JJOfPI5asz1CfuShZT1rH50CASYmLg2pcqxMW0ObCMcgTwXv4JDcvhQldwgQ2grGqgpU2Sxn5AfMqAjO69H9EmlgFAoI7fdTKnsKuzgJjBOQoCkyR-2B3v1Dsc-3D
The user came to your website from:
The user's landing page on your website: https://u18544399.ct.sendgrid.net/ls/click?upn=sXQUDoQj05z-2FxEGEbtb89zDTaZ0N1UvuTbR7FyWzvaJavoRG8ALY-2B2Je8thIo9-2BUi72VfGj6vjN76zw-2FDtUg8A-3D-3D1nFp_EYd3yy3irBU3zwlsicGM1Hzrm5Je3eXAF7oRZNqeNtcWGBmfX9iEICOO1xxhIt-2FIOpZMOlPDmBkViDGt3lija6hOtJ93CtUS0bJacdSXqdJL0IIsSlivxLF7dB-2BI2SO1k27MC4plA-2BmP2CkiHH1y9OuIx0PNy-2BkLHPmPrfglPrloulduamAaJyZyS6PgQo5F8JOLNVN-2FYphyBvkPc6ill7JZBBdkA-2FfXer3dwwAIsJ8-3D
User's browser is: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/105.0.0.0 Safari/537.36
You see the above example which I am receiving. kindly help us to fix this.
]]>